The Graduate Certificate in Health Education for Adults is a postgraduate program designed to equip students with the knowledge and skills necessary to educate and promote healthy behaviors among adults.
This program focuses on the application of health education principles and practices to improve the health and well-being of diverse populations, particularly adults.
Learning outcomes of the Graduate Certificate in Health Education for Adults include the ability to design and implement effective health education programs, assess health education needs, and evaluate the impact of health education interventions.
The program typically takes one year to complete and consists of coursework and a capstone project.
The Graduate Certificate in Health Education for Adults is relevant to the health education industry, as it provides students with the skills and knowledge necessary to work in various settings, such as hospitals, community organizations, and government agencies.
Graduates of this program can pursue careers in health education, health promotion, and health policy, and can also work as health educators, health coaches, or health advocates.
